  • MODULE 1 | Intro to Learning Languages

    This module consists of several chapters related to the topic of language learning. Key lessons include: Classroom Values, Icebreaker Activities, Student Needs, Learning Styles, Proficiency Levels, Second Language Acquisition (SLA), and the connections between Language and Culture.

  • MODULE 2 | Teaching and Lesson Planning

    This module features several lessons related to the topic of teaching. Key lessons include: Teaching Methods, Designing Quick-and-Easy Lesson Plans Using PPP, Using Lesson Plan Templates, and Creating Resources for your Lesson Plans.

  • MODULE 3 | Teaching the Macro Skills

    This is our most popular module, and it features 14 chapters and resources that focus on how to teach the four basic macro skills: Speaking, Listening, Reading, Writing. We will also look at how to teach a number of micro skills: Pronunciation, Poetry, Literacy, and Grammar.

  • MODULE 4 | Advanced Teaching Techniques

    Module 4 consists of 11 chapters that focus on more advanced teaching techniques. Key lessons include: Classroom Management, Error Correction, How to Design and Conduct your own Language Tests, and How to adapt Course Books using Authentic Materials.

  • MODULE 5 | Teaching English As Ministry

    This module gives you access to a library of resources that you can use to teach English as a ministry: including our “Fun Activities” booklet, lesson ideas for teaching children, Discovery Bible Study resources for church teams, and our C&C Magazine curricula.

  • MODULE 6 | Teaching Portfolio

    In this final module, you will create a portfolio with some of the lesson plans and resources you designed during the course. We will also guide you through the assessment process for receiving your Professional Certificate and finishing the course!
